Plaxico Burress spent the Giants' first practices Friday doing the same thing he did at nearly every practice last year. But was he standing on the sidelines because his ankle was bothering him again? Or were his unfinished contract negotiations bothering him, too?
That wasn't clear when the defending champs returned to the football field without their No. 1 receiver. Burress' agent, Drew Rosenhaus, insisted the absence was "definitely not connected" to his contract. But Tom Coughlin didn't sound so sure. "I'm not sure what that issue is," the coach said after the morning practice. "Until I have more information, I am not commenting. I just said all I can say." Continue
